"The Prince Consort is a beautiful Grade 2 listed building that lies in the heart of Netley Abbey village. It has been newly refurbished and offers a light contemporary feel whilst offering the traditional warm welcome of a family run pub. It offers a full range of beers including a choice of real ales and a good selection of wines to suit all tastes. The family friendly restaurant is open 7 days a week and boasts a varied menu of fresh, home cooked food. Sunday Lunch is available and booking is recommended."
